ok since we're on this topic, here's the pictures i promised a while ago. been busy lately. :sian:

 

one is the air filter, and 1 is air cleaner. 1 is new and the other is after 10k mileage. :smile:

 

Our CBR150 have 2 type of air cleaning element - air filter & air cleaner. They are located at different places. 1 is below the fuel tank & the other by the side of the bike seat, respectively.

all have both, T10 size bulbs. careful if u're buying aftermarkete ones, usually their wattage is way higher than stock. causing it to blow again prematurely. :sian: 1.7Watts is the stock wattage if my memory didn't fail me. limbat can confirm? :confused:

 

Guys confirm our meter T10 bulbs are only 12v 1.7amp anything higher will give problem ...................... :)
